Xshell操作指南:轻松实现远程重启电脑
如何用Xshell重启电脑

首页 2024-12-08 14:19:14



如何用Xshell重启电脑:高效管理远程服务器的必备技能 在现代网络环境中,服务器作为数据存储和应用的基石,其稳定性和性能至关重要

    无论是Linux、Windows还是macOS服务器,定期重启都是维护系统健康和提高性能的重要手段

    然而,对于远程管理的服务器,如何高效且安全地进行重启操作呢?本文将详细介绍如何使用Xshell这一强大的远程终端管理工具来重启电脑,并提供一些实用技巧和注意事项,帮助读者更好地管理远程服务器

     一、Xshell简介 Xshell是一款功能强大的远程终端管理工具,支持多种操作系统,包括Windows、Linux、macOS等,通过SSH、SFTP等协议实现远程连接和管理

    它提供了友好的用户界面和丰富的功能,如命令行操作、文件传输、会话管理等,极大地提高了远程管理的效率和便捷性

     二、如何用Xshell重启电脑 1. Linux服务器重启 Linux服务器因其稳定性和开源特性,在企业和个人用户中广泛应用

    使用Xshell重启Linux服务器的步骤如下: 1.连接服务器:首先,打开Xshell并创建一个新的会话,输入服务器的IP地址、端口号(默认22)和用户名,选择SSH协议进行连接

    如果服务器配置了SSH密钥认证,可以选择使用密钥文件进行登录

     2.获取管理员权限:在成功连接后,会进入Linux服务器的命令行界面

    由于重启操作需要管理员权限,因此需要使用`sudo`命令提升权限

    例如,输入`sudo -i`或`sudo su`切换到root用户

     3.执行重启命令:在获得管理员权限后,可以直接输入重启命令

    Linux中常用的重启命令有`sudoreboot`和`sudo shutdown -rnow`

    这两个命令都会立即重启服务器

    输入命令后,按下回车键执行

     4.确认重启:在执行重启命令后,系统会提示用户确认操作

    在Linux中,通常会显示一个倒计时,用户可以在倒计时结束前取消重启操作(如果需要)

    但一旦倒计时结束或用户确认重启,服务器将立即重启

     2. Windows服务器重启 虽然Windows服务器不如Linux服务器那样普遍,但在某些应用场景下,它仍然是不可或缺的选择

    使用Xshell重启Windows服务器的步骤如下: 1.连接服务器:与Linux服务器类似,首先需要打开Xshell并创建一个新的会话,输入服务器的IP地址、端口号(Windows服务器通常使用3389端口进行远程桌面连接,但Xshell通过SSH连接时仍使用22端口)和用户名进行连接

     2.执行重启命令:在成功连接后,进入Windows服务器的命令行界面

    由于Windows的命令行操作与Linux有所不同,因此需要使用Windows特有的命令来重启服务器

    在Windows Server中,可以使用`shutdown /r /t 0`命令来立即重启服务器

    其中,`/r`表示重启,`/t 0`表示不延迟

     3.确认重启:在执行重启命令后,系统会提示用户确认操作

    用户需要确认重启操作,然后服务器将立即重启

     3. macOS服务器重启 macOS服务器虽然不如Linux和Windows服务器那样普遍,但在一些特定的应用场景下,它仍然具有一定的优势

    使用Xshell重启macOS服务器的步骤与Linux服务器类似: 1.连接服务器:打开Xshell并创建一个新的会话,输入服务器的IP地址、端口号和用户名进行连接

    macOS服务器的SSH端口通常也是22

     2.获取管理员权限:在成功连接后,进入macOS服务器的命令行界面

    同样需要使用`sudo`命令提升权限

     3.执行重启命令:在获得管理员权限后,可以直接输入重启命令

    macOS中常用的重启命令与Linux类似,如`sudo reboot`或`sudo shutdown -r now`

     4.确认重启:在执行重启命令后,系统会提示用户确认操作

    确认后,服务器将立即重启

     三、注意事项和技巧 1.保存工作:在重启服务器之前,务必确保已经保存所有未完成的工作,并通知相关用户,以免造成数据丢失或服务中断

     2.检查网络连接:在使用Xshell进行远程连接时,网络稳定性至关重要

    如果网络不稳定,可能会导致连接中断或无法正常操作

    因此,在重启服务器之前,建议检查本地网络连接是否正常,并尝试重启路由器或切换到更稳定的网络环境

     3.检查服务器资源:服务器的配置错误或资源不足也可能导致重启操作失败

    因此,在重启之前,建议检查服务器的CPU、内存和网络带宽使用情况,确保服务器有足够的资源处理连接请求

    如果服务器负载过高,可以考虑优化配置或升级硬件

     4.防火墙和安全设置:防火墙或安全设置可能会拦截或过滤SSH连接请求,导致Xshell无法正常连接到服务器

    因此,在重启之前,建议检查服务器和本地计算机上的防火墙设置,确保允许Xshell的通信端口(如SSH端口22)正常通信

     5.软件冲突:其他网络应用程序可能与Xshell发生冲突,导致连接异常

    因此,在重启之前,建议关闭其他不必要的网络应用程序,特别是那些使用大量带宽或修改网络设置的软件

     6.Xshell设置:Xshell本身的设置问题也可能导致连接异常

    因此,在重启之前,建议检查Xshell的连接设置,确保使用正确的协议和端口

    如果遇到连接问题,可以尝试重置Xshell的设置或升级到最新版